10 Service Fixture & Tools

10.1. Service Position

10.1.1. Extension Cables for Service Position
Using the following Extension Cables, place the unit as shown for check and service.
Note:
1. The LCD open/close Switch is for changing between LCD Display and EVF Display. When turning on EVF Display, place some
paper or tape, etc. on LCD open/close Switch so that this Switch stays ON.
2. To eject the Mechanism, hold down the Eject Switch on the Rear Unit for a short time.
3. Use a grounded ESD wrist strap while disassembling the Lens portion.
4. Connect the F.P.C.s to the connectors, verifying the direction of F.P.C.s.
The Main P.C.B. or a Chip part will be especially damaged if the 90 Pin Extension Cable (LSUA0060) is misconnected.
5. Use extreme care when plugging or unplugging in connectors.
